How much solar power does Georgia have?

Georgia has the seventh-highest solar capacity among all states at 5,485 MW as of Oct. 2023. According to the SEIA, Georgia could add 3,485 MW of solar power between 2024 and 2028. This forecast represents a growth rate of more than 63% within five years. Georgia’s solar industry has received over $6.1 billion in cumulative investment.

How do I find a solar installer in Georgia?

Ask for licenses: Solar installers in Georgia need to be associated with a "licensed electrical contractor," according to the state government. You can ask potential installers or search their licenses with the state or a national certifying board, like the North American Board of Certified Energy Practitioners.
